Company overview

Next earnings: 2026-07-29(1d)

NWPX Infrastructure, Inc., together with its subsidiaries, manufactures and sells water-related infrastructure products in the United States and Canada. It operates through two segments, Water Transmission Systems (WTS); and Precast Infrastructure and Engineered Systems (Precast). The WTS segment manufactures large-diameter, high-pressure steel pipeline systems for use in water infrastructure applications, which are primarily related to drinking water systems. Its products are also used for hydroelectric power systems, wastewater systems, seismic resiliency, and other applications. The Precast segment offers stormwater and wastewater technology products, precast, and reinforced concrete products, including reinforced concrete pipe, manholes, box culverts, vaults and catch basins, pump lift stations, oil water separators, biofiltration units, and other environmental and engineered solutions. It provides its products under the NWPX Geneva and NWPX Park brand names; and manufactures engineered water transmission systems and produces steel casing pipe, bar-wrapped concrete cylinder pipe, and pipeline system joints and fittings under the Northwest Pipe Company brand. In addition, the company provides solution-based products for various markets, including reinforced precast concrete products, lined precast sanitary sewer system structures, water distribution and management equipment including pump lift stations, wastewater pretreatment, and stormwater quality products. Further, it sells water infrastructure products to installation contractors. The company was formerly known as Northwest Pipe Company and changed its name to NWPX Infrastructure, Inc. in June 2025. NWPX Infrastructure, Inc. was incorporated in 1966 and is headquartered in Vancouver, Washington.
